hello.

i have a noobie question..and one more..

 

1. when I play online with others and im offline for 24 hours (job/sleep etc) what happens to my city?

 

 what happens to other players that are online,if we connect somehow (education,tourism,water etc)

 

2.every time i try to find an empty spot for me to join a region with others,no free spot empty to claim.

am I doing something wrong?

Hey Silky,

 

I believe when you go offline your city simply pauses until you sign in again, any connections with the other towns like sharing utilities or so on would still take place from what I've seen.

As for the second question, they had to temporarily disable the region filters until they could optimize it so as to not bog down the servers, at least that was my understanding.  Last I read was they are going to start bringing that back in within a week or so.
